Kazan: Korea Republic struck twice in second half added time to defeat Germany 2-0, a result which sent the defending champions crashing out of the 2018 FIFA World Cup Russia on Wednesday.
The win wasn't enough for Korea Republic to advance to the Round of 16, with Sweden defeating Mexico 3-0 to seal top spot in Group F, but it is a result which will be celebrated across Asia.
It was a historic win as it is the first time an Asian team has beaten the reigning World Cup champions in any official match.
